Overview

Postcode NW10 2QJ is located in a major urban area, within the Willesden Green ward of Brent in the London region, and forms part of the Willesden Green area. It has very high deprivation and very high crime levels, with around 148.6 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, roughly 1.1× the London average of 130 per 1,000. The average income per household in Willesden Green is £61,273 per year. The nearest station is Willesden Green, about 0.2 miles away. There are 11 primary and 2 secondary schools in the area.

Frequently asked questions about NW10 2QJ

Is NW10 2QJ (Willesden Green) safe?

The area around NW10 2QJ records about 149 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, which is a very high crime rate for England: it scores 9 out of 10 on the Area360 crime scale, where 10 is the highest crime level. Across London as a whole the rate is about 130 per 1,000. The most common offences locally are anti-social behaviour, violence and sexual offences and vehicle crime.

What is the average house price near NW10 2QJ?

The median sale price around NW10 2QJ in Willesden Green is £588,000 (about £654 per square foot) based on 94 registered sales according to HM Land Registry data.

What schools are near NW10 2QJ?

There are 20 schools close to NW10 2QJ, including Convent of Jesus and Mary RC Infant School (Outstanding), St Mary Magdalen's Catholic Junior School (Good) and Gladstone Park Primary School (Good). Ratings are from the latest Ofsted inspections.

What is the nearest station to NW10 2QJ?

The closest station to NW10 2QJ is Willesden Green in TfL zone 2,3, about 245 m away, serving the Jubilee line.

How deprived is the area around NW10 2QJ?

NW10 2QJ scores 9 out of 10 on the deprivation scale, where 10 is the most deprived. Its neighbourhood ranks 5,942 of 32,844 in England on the official Index of Multiple Deprivation (rank 1 is the most deprived).
